• In synchronous mode, the transmitter is enabled only when both the receiver and
transmitter are both enabled.
• It is recommended that the receiver is the last enabled and the first disabled.
When operating in synchronous mode, only the bit clock, frame sync, and transmitter/
receiver enable are shared. The transmitter and receiver otherwise operate independently,
although configuration registers must be configured consistently across both the
transmitter and receiver.
49.4.4 Frame sync configuration
When enabled, the SAI continuously transmits and/or receives frames of data. Each
frame consists of a fixed number of words and each word consists of a fixed number of
bits. Within each frame, any given word can be masked causing the receiver to ignore
that word and the transmitter to tri-state for the duration of that word.
The frame sync signal is used to indicate the start of each frame. A valid frame sync
requires a rising edge (if active high) or falling edge (if active low) to be detected and the
transmitter or receiver cannot be busy with a previous frame. A valid frame sync is also
ignored (slave mode) or not generated (master mode) for the first four bit clock cycles
after enabling the transmitter or receiver.
The transmitter and receiver frame sync can be configured independently with any of the
following options:
• Externally generated or internally generated
• Active high or active low
• Assert with the first bit in frame or asserts one bit early
• Assert for a duration between 1 bit clock and the first word length
• Frame length from 1 to 32 words per frame
• Word length to support 8 to 32 bits per word
• First word length and remaining word lengths can be configured separately
• Words can be configured to transmit/receive MSB first or LSB first
These configuration options cannot be changed after the SAI transmitter or receiver is
enabled.
